On this wind blown island the 7th Inf. Div. take time out for C Rations. Seeking shelter from the wind alongside cement fortifications, they sit on the gournd strewn with dead Japs.
Photoprint by Cordray.
No. SC 212610.
Joseph J. Spagnola Collection.
This record contains unverified data from caption card.
Caption card tracings: Ph. Ind.; Geogr.; WWII: Death; Eating; Army, U.S. Units.
